The 2024 KIA Niro EV, a compact electric crossover, continues its legacy as a popular choice for eco-conscious buyers. First introduced in 2017, the Niro EV has evolved into its second generation for 2023, bringing significant updates. For 2024, it is offered in key trims like the Wind and Wave. Pricing typically starts in the mid-$40,000s, making it an accessible entry into the EV market. Its popularity stems from a blend of practicality, affordability, and a refined electric driving experience.

2024 KIA Niro EV: Quick Overview

  • Engine Options: The 2024 KIA Niro EV features a single, powerful electric motor driving the front wheels.
  • Horsepower: It produces 201 horsepower.
  • Torque: Delivers 188 lb-ft of torque.
  • Battery: Equipped with a 64.8 kWh battery pack.
  • Fuel Economy (EPA Estimated): Approximately 113 MPGe city / 100 MPGe highway / 106 MPGe combined. These figures can vary slightly based on driving conditions and wheel size.
  • Range (EPA Estimated): Up to 253 miles on a full charge.
  • 0-60 Times: Estimated to be around 7.8 seconds.
  • Towing Capacity: The KIA Niro EV does not have a towing capacity.
  • Trim-Level Features:
    Wind Trim: Includes standard features like 17-inch alloy wheels, LED headlights and taillights, a 10.25-inch touchscreen infotainment system with navigation, Apple CarPlay & Android Auto, dual-zone automatic climate control, heated front seats, a leather-wrapped steering wheel, wireless phone charging, and a suite of driver-assistance features (e.g., Forward Collision-Avoidance Assist, Lane Keeping Assist, Blind-Spot Collision-Avoidance Assist).
    Wave Trim: Builds upon the Wind trim with premium additions such as a power-operated sunroof, vegan leather upholstery, a power-adjustable driver's seat, ventilated front seats, a Harman Kardon premium audio system, and an Intelligent Speed Limit Assist.

What Problems Does the 2024 KIA Niro EV Have?

As a relatively new model in its second generation, the 2024 KIA Niro EV has not yet accumulated a significant history of widely reported long-term reliability concerns or common issues. The previous generation of the Niro EV (prior to 2023 redesign) did experience some isolated reports related to battery thermal management and charging issues, but these were not widespread and have largely been addressed in newer models. For the current 2024 model year, recalls have been minimal. However, as with any electric vehicle, owners should monitor battery health indicators and adhere to recommended maintenance schedules. Some early adopters of EVs, in general, sometimes report minor software glitches or issues with charging equipment, but these are typically resolved through over-the-air updates or dealer service. Long-term reliability for the 2024 Niro EV is anticipated to be strong, building on KIA's overall improving reputation for vehicle quality and its dedicated EV platform. Owners should pay attention to any manufacturer bulletins or recalls, though none of significant concern have been widely reported for this specific model year to date. The focus for long-term care will largely be on battery longevity and efficient charging practices.

How long will the 2024 KIA Niro EV last?

Based on typical EV owner data and maintenance habits, the 2024 KIA Niro EV is expected to offer a long service life, potentially exceeding 10-15 years or 150,000-200,000 miles before major component replacements become a significant concern. The electric drivetrain is inherently simpler and has fewer moving parts than internal combustion engines, contributing to its durability. The primary long-term concern for any EV is battery degradation. However, KIA's battery technology and warranty (10 years/100,000 miles for battery and powertrain) suggest strong longevity. Regular charging practices, avoiding consistent deep discharges or overcharging, and maintaining moderate battery temperatures will maximize its lifespan. Other components like suspension and brakes, benefiting from regenerative braking, may also see extended life compared to traditional vehicles.

What Technology & Safety Features are Included?

The 2024 KIA Niro EV is well-equipped with modern technology, entertainment, and advanced safety features. Standard across trims is a robust infotainment system featuring a 10.25-inch touchscreen with integrated navigation, Apple CarPlay, and Android Auto. This system provides intuitive access to media, phone connectivity, and vehicle settings. The driver benefits from a digital instrument cluster that displays crucial driving information, including range and charging status.

Driver-assistance and safety features are a strong suit. Standard on all models is KIA's Drive Wise suite, which includes Forward Collision-Avoidance Assist with pedestrian and cyclist detection, Lane Keeping Assist, Lane Departure Warning, Blind-Spot Collision-Avoidance Assist, Rear Cross-Traffic Collision-Avoidance Assist, and Driver Attention Warning. Higher trims, like the Wave, may add Intelligent Speed Limit Assist and Highway Driving Assist.

Optional features, primarily found on the top-tier Wave trim, include a power sunroof for a more open cabin feel and a premium Harman Kardon audio system for enhanced sound quality.

Regarding crash-test ratings, while specific ratings for the 2024 model year may still be pending or updated by organizations like the NHTSA and IIHS, the previous generation of the Niro EV has consistently performed well in safety tests. It has received high marks for its structural integrity and effectiveness of its safety systems. The 2023 redesign, which carries over to 2024, is expected to maintain or improve upon these strong safety credentials.

2024 KIA Niro EV Prices and Market Value

When new, the 2024 KIA Niro EV typically starts in the mid-$40,000 range for the base Wind trim, with the more equipped Wave trim commanding a higher price, often in the high-$40,000s before any potential federal or state tax credits. Current used market prices are still developing due to the model's recent introduction. However, initial depreciation for EVs, including the Niro EV, can be steeper in the first few years compared to gasoline-powered vehicles, though this trend is stabilizing. Factors influencing resale value include battery health, mileage, overall condition, trim level, and the availability of charging infrastructure and EV incentives in a given region. A well-maintained Niro EV with good battery health and desirable features will hold its value better over time.

2024 KIA Niro EV Cost of Ownership

The 2024 KIA Niro EV is generally economical to own. Electricity costs are significantly lower than gasoline, and fuel savings are substantial. Maintenance costs are also reduced due to the simpler EV powertrain, with fewer fluids to change and fewer mechanical parts to fail. Insurance premiums can be slightly higher for EVs compared to comparable gasoline cars due to their higher initial cost and repair complexity, but this varies by insurer and location. Repair costs, especially for battery issues outside of warranty, can be significant, but the Niro EV benefits from KIA's comprehensive battery warranty. Overall, its low running costs make it an economical choice for long-term ownership.

How Does the 2024 KIA Niro EV Compare to Other Sport Utility Vehicle?

The 2024 KIA Niro EV competes in a crowded compact electric crossover segment, facing strong rivals like the Hyundai Kona Electric, Chevrolet Bolt EUV, and Volkswagen ID.4.

Performance: The Niro EV's 201 hp and 253-mile range are competitive, offering brisk acceleration. The Hyundai Kona Electric offers similar performance and range. The Chevy Bolt EUV is slightly less powerful with a comparable range, while the ID.4 boasts more power and potentially longer range depending on configuration.

Features: KIA excels in offering a comprehensive suite of standard technology and driver-assistance features across its trims, often including a larger infotainment screen than competitors at a similar price point. The Niro EV's interior is also praised for its spaciousness and modern design. The Kona Electric and Bolt EUV also offer good tech, while the ID.4 provides a more minimalist, tech-forward cabin.

Reliability: KIA has a strong reputation for reliability, and the Niro EV benefits from a solid warranty, particularly for its battery. Competitors like Hyundai also have good reliability records. Chevrolet's Bolt models have had some past battery concerns, though largely addressed. Volkswagen's ID.4 is newer to the market, and its long-term reliability is still being established.

Price: The Niro EV's pricing, starting in the mid-$40,000s, is generally competitive, especially considering its standard features. The Bolt EUV is typically more affordable. The Kona Electric is similarly priced, while the ID.4 can be more expensive depending on the trim.

Recommendations:
- Similar Alternative: The Hyundai Kona Electric is a very close cousin, offering similar driving dynamics, range, and value, often with slight styling differences.
- More Affordable: The Chevrolet Bolt EUV is an excellent option if budget is a primary concern, offering good range and practicality at a lower price point.
- More Premium/Performance: The Volkswagen ID.4 might be considered if a larger footprint, more potent acceleration, or a more expansive cargo area are desired, though it comes at a higher cost.
